Must ensure safety

Those who arrange leisure activities are responsible for your safety. The responsibility applies to adapted areas, such as in playgrounds and climbing parks, and to activities such as diving courses, kayak trips, and rafting, for private individuals.

The responsibility applies to both commercial actors and voluntary clubs or teams, and regardless of whether you pay to participate or not. The organiser must also have assessed the risk of the service.

What is a consumer service?

A consumer service is an organised leisure activity that you as a private individual can participate in. If you join an organized mountain hike, you are participating in an active service. Tenesta is passive if, for example, you are a spectator at a sports event. Both are considered consumer services. Training and rental or lending of equipment are also part of the service.
